sibling bond romance books
The brother or sister who'd burn the world down for you — fierce family loyalty beneath the romance.
Sibling bond is the feeling of fierce family loyalty running underneath a love story. You tag a book this way for the warmth of a brother who'd do anything for his sister, the sisters who've survived everything together, the protective older sibling, the chaotic-but-devoted family unit that anchors a character even as they fall in love. It's distinct from found family — this is blood, history, and the particular fierceness of people who've known you your whole life.
The feeling is loyalty with teeth and banter. There's the sibling who vets the love interest within an inch of their life, the one who shows up the second everything falls apart, the family bond a romance has to fit alongside rather than replace. It often runs through series where each sibling gets their book, and it's frequently what makes a whole series feel like coming home each time you return.
